国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
国内IP代理推荐:
天启|企业级代理IP(>>>点击注册免费测试<<<)
神龙|纯净稳定代理IP(>>>点击注册免费测试<<<)
互联网高速发展,数据获取方式从过去的复制粘贴,耗费人力时间转变为通过网络爬虫快速获取筛选目标数据,大大提供工作效率。
而另一面,网站平台为防止数据被爬,不断更新迭代严格的反爬机制。这一举措也给网络爬虫带来了限制,致使用户使用爬虫爬取数据时经常会遇到IP受限无法访问的情况。
对于网络爬虫在爬取数据时很容易被网站识别出来,进而对其进行限制,如IP被封禁,访问频率被限制等。
为了避免这些限制,以下是一些常见的网络爬虫防止IP被限制的方法:
1、使用代理IP:
使用代理ip可以隐藏真实IP地址,避免被封禁。同时,还可以轮换ip地址,避免被检测出是爬虫。
2、控制爬取频率:
避免在短时间内过于频繁地访问同一个网站,这样容易被网站识别出来是爬虫。可以设置一个爬取时间间隔,如每个页面爬取之间的等待时间,以避免过于频繁的访问。
3、遵守网站的robots协议:
爬虫访问网站时需要遵守robots协议,即robots.txt文件,该文件指示了哪些页面是可以爬取的,哪些是不可以的。遵守这个协议可以避免被封禁。
4、使用随机User-Agent:
User-Agent是浏览器或爬虫向网站服务器发送请求时的身份标识。使用随机的User-Agent可以避免被检测出是爬虫。
5、使用验证码识别技术:
部分网站会设置验证码来防止爬虫的访问,可以使用验证码识别技术来自动识别验证码。
总之,防止IP被限制的关键在于模拟真实用户的行为,遵守网站规则,并使用多种技术手段来隐藏爬虫的身份。
优质代理ip服务商推荐:
使用方法:点击下方对应产品前往官网→注册账号→联系客服免费试用→购买需要的套餐→前往不同的场景使用代理IP
国外IP代理推荐:
IPIPGO|全球住宅代理IP(>>>点击注册免费测试<<<)
神龙海外代理(>>>点击注册免费测试<<<)
国内ip代理推荐:
天启|企业级代理IP(>>>点击注册免费测试<<<)
神龙|纯净稳定代理IP(>>>点击注册免费测试<<<)
发表评论
发表评论: